If you are a South African youth who wants a real start in the energy sector, the Eskom Youth Employment Service Programme is open now and will close on 31 July 2026. This is a chance to earn a market‑related salary while you learn on the job.
What the opportunity is
Eskom is hiring three interns for its Water and Environmental Operations Department in Sunninghill, Gauteng. The posts are rated YY1 and are part of the Primary Energy Business Unit. Each placement is a 12‑month contract and is paid at market rates.
Who can apply
To be eligible you must meet all of the following:
- South African citizen
- Age between 18 and 34 years
- Grade 12 or an equivalent qualification (no university degree needed)
- Unemployed and not studying full‑time during the contract year
- Never taken part in the YES programme before
- Not been permanently employed by the same employer for more than one continuous year
- Willing to complete Eskom’s recruitment and selection process
- Available for the full 12‑month period
What you gain
The YES programme gives you:
- Practical experience in South Africa’s biggest power utility
- Exposure to water and environmental operations, administration and field support
- Professional workplace habits – health & safety, ethics, customer service
- Reference letters and contacts for future job searches
- Development of key skills such as communication, teamwork, negotiation, professionalism, integrity and a customer‑focused attitude
